If You Can't Save Yourself From Doing Mistakes, Toshiba's Easyguard Saves You!

 

Author: John Gibb

We are humans and we all do mistakes but since the saying "to err is human; to forgive is divine!" won't come to any help when you have just smashed your laptop by mistakenly letting it fall; somebody has to think about saving you from the consequences. The solution to situations like this one is the Toshiba's new EasyGuard laptop series! EasyGuard features special characteristics that are aimed at helping your laptop live longer even when you are working under the most severe conditions.

EasyGuard laptops come with rubber fortified corners which will protect the interior parts of the laptop in the event of a sudden fall. Additionally, EasyGuard is fortified with sealed keyboards that protect the laptop from spills as well as interior rubber protectors and air cells. Those physically present features are the first line of defense against bad environmental conditions and human mistakes. Dropping down a laptop by mistake is something that doesn't happen every day; but when it happens, it can be a disaster.

What's really amazing about EasyGuard's technology is that it contains motion sensors which will automatically detect any sudden falls; if the motion detectors are activated then the built - in shock absorbers will do their job to protect your precious laptop from a possibly fatal crash. Those great features will help you protect the physical components of your EasyGuard but that's not all there is about this laptop; Toshiba has also though about protection of the non - physical components.

Toshiba puts in use some of the most advanced security features; this includes a TPMC (Trusted Platform Module-compatible) data encryption chip as well as USB flash drive/SD Card in order to keep the decryption keys securely. Regarding connectivity, EasyGuard features a Bluetooth and 2 WiFi antennae. The two WiFi antennae can provide a better connectivity while Toshiba's ConfigFree utility will help the laptop user with any network issues that might appear.

Obviously, Toshiba's EasyGuard laptops, as the name suggests are aimed at helping you out with difficult situations / conditions. EasyGuard will not only provide you with improved connectivity and data security but it will also do it's best to lessen the effects of a sudden fall or a strong hit that it might suffer. Tackling those difficult situations can always save you time, effort and of course money! EasyGuard could by no means be considered overpriced and companies seeking to minimize their IT expenses should definitely consider it's advantages.
